As I posted in another thread, those two 777s are still at Goodyear. I saw them last Sunday. I had been wondering how long they would be there since they arrived around September of last year. They are all white, with no markings. You can actually trace the history of the last 6 months of those 777s through a photo search in this site.

From what I can gather, they were prepped for K6 at Cardiff. After service with K6, they were painted all white at FRA and then sent to Marana. From Marana, they took a short hop to GYR, where they have been ever since.

I don't know when Varig is supposed to take delivery because those birds haven't moved really at all in the last 5 months. If anything, they have been repositioned to make room for a former KLM 747-200, that is currently being stripped of parts. I would take photos, but this site won't allow digital. Too big of a file it seems.

However, I did notice the new arrival of 2 Varig 767s since I was there last. There also must be 2 or 3 Varig MD-11s too.
